Sounds like you have set your mind onto the switch 810 :) Pros rather cheap for what you get Dust filters is awesome window although they could have cut the edge so you dont have to see the 5.25 inch bays Lots of cooling options integrated 120/140mm support in all the fan holes Cons Its flimsy, if you like me dont want the whole HDD trays the construct becomes really flimsy, might be worth considering if you are planing to move it around alot To little space for cable management Bottom dustfilters are in the way if you have to move it and they fall out easily Cannot have 280 rad in the bottom without modifying it, nor in the front Lots of plastic Now its up to you :D good luck! //D-tail

Below is taken from this thread: http://answers.microsoft.com/en-us/windows/forum/windows_7-system/winloadexe-missing-or-corrupt-0xc000000e-windows-7/17ed7169-3b01-47e7-b99f-14704a37b1c4 Might help you in the process. OK, I created a Windows 7 System Repair Disc (http://windows.microsoft.com/en-us/windows7/Create-a-system-repair-disc) this does the same as with the Windows 7 Installation disc except it takes you straight to Recovery/Repair options. I booted to the Windows 7 System Repair Disc and it displayed both operating systems. I highlighted the problematic one and clicked next. I then ran Startup Repair which reported "Startup Repair could not detect a problem." I then ran the cmd prompt. I did bootrec /fixmbr and it reported "the operation completed successfully." I then did bootrec /fixboot and it reported "the operation completed successfully. I then restarted the computer and tried to boot it to the problematic OS, but it still says winload.exe is missing or corrupt error 0xc000000e
